Home
last modified time | relevance | path

Searched refs:clk_bulk_disable_unprepare (Results 1 – 25 of 115) sorted by relevance

12345

/openbmc/linux/drivers/pmdomain/imx/
H A Dimx93-pd.c82 clk_bulk_disable_unprepare(domain->num_clks, domain->clks); in imx93_pd_off()
94 clk_bulk_disable_unprepare(domain->num_clks, domain->clks); in imx93_pd_remove()
154 clk_bulk_disable_unprepare(domain->num_clks, domain->clks); in imx93_pd_probe()
H A Dimx93-blk-ctrl.c140 clk_bulk_disable_unprepare(bc->num_clks, bc->clks); in imx93_blk_ctrl_power_on()
163 clk_bulk_disable_unprepare(data->num_clks, domain->clks); in imx93_blk_ctrl_power_on()
165 clk_bulk_disable_unprepare(bc->num_clks, bc->clks); in imx93_blk_ctrl_power_on()
183 clk_bulk_disable_unprepare(data->num_clks, domain->clks); in imx93_blk_ctrl_power_off()
185 clk_bulk_disable_unprepare(bc->num_clks, bc->clks); in imx93_blk_ctrl_power_off()
H A Dimx8mp-blk-ctrl.c235 clk_bulk_disable_unprepare(num_clks, usb_clk); in imx8mp_hsio_power_notifier()
246 clk_bulk_disable_unprepare(num_clks, usb_clk); in imx8mp_hsio_power_notifier()
558 clk_bulk_disable_unprepare(data->num_clks, domain->clks); in imx8mp_blk_ctrl_power_on()
563 clk_bulk_disable_unprepare(data->num_clks, domain->clks); in imx8mp_blk_ctrl_power_on()
586 clk_bulk_disable_unprepare(data->num_clks, domain->clks); in imx8mp_blk_ctrl_power_off()
/openbmc/linux/drivers/usb/cdns3/
H A Dcdns3-starfive.c97 clk_bulk_disable_unprepare(data->num_clks, data->clks); in cdns_clk_rst_init()
104 clk_bulk_disable_unprepare(data->num_clks, data->clks); in cdns_clk_rst_deinit()
195 clk_bulk_disable_unprepare(data->num_clks, data->clks); in cdns_starfive_runtime_suspend()
H A Dcdns3-imx.c217 clk_bulk_disable_unprepare(data->num_clks, data->clks); in cdns_imx_probe()
228 clk_bulk_disable_unprepare(data->num_clks, data->clks); in cdns_imx_remove()
358 clk_bulk_disable_unprepare(data->num_clks, data->clks); in cdns_imx_suspend()
/openbmc/linux/drivers/net/ethernet/stmicro/stmmac/
H A Ddwmac-tegra.c66 clk_bulk_disable_unprepare(ARRAY_SIZE(mgbe_clks), mgbe->clks); in tegra_mgbe_suspend()
103 clk_bulk_disable_unprepare(ARRAY_SIZE(mgbe_clks), mgbe->clks); in tegra_mgbe_resume()
109 clk_bulk_disable_unprepare(ARRAY_SIZE(mgbe_clks), mgbe->clks); in tegra_mgbe_resume()
370 clk_bulk_disable_unprepare(ARRAY_SIZE(mgbe_clks), mgbe->clks); in tegra_mgbe_probe()
379 clk_bulk_disable_unprepare(ARRAY_SIZE(mgbe_clks), mgbe->clks); in tegra_mgbe_remove()
/openbmc/linux/drivers/usb/dwc3/
H A Ddwc3-of-simple.c87 clk_bulk_disable_unprepare(simple->num_clocks, simple->clks); in dwc3_of_simple_probe()
102 clk_bulk_disable_unprepare(simple->num_clocks, simple->clks); in __dwc3_of_simple_teardown()
H A Ddwc3-xilinx.c306 clk_bulk_disable_unprepare(priv_data->num_clocks, priv_data->clks); in dwc3_xlnx_probe()
318 clk_bulk_disable_unprepare(priv_data->num_clocks, priv_data->clks); in dwc3_xlnx_remove()
/openbmc/linux/drivers/usb/mtu3/
H A Dmtu3_plat.c162 clk_bulk_disable_unprepare(BULK_CLKS_CNT, ssusb->clks); in ssusb_rscs_init()
171 clk_bulk_disable_unprepare(BULK_CLKS_CNT, ssusb->clks); in ssusb_rscs_exit()
541 clk_bulk_disable_unprepare(BULK_CLKS_CNT, ssusb->clks); in mtu3_suspend_common()
570 clk_bulk_disable_unprepare(BULK_CLKS_CNT, ssusb->clks); in mtu3_resume_common()
/openbmc/linux/drivers/regulator/
H A Duniphier-regulator.c113 clk_bulk_disable_unprepare(priv->data->nclks, priv->clk); in uniphier_regulator_probe()
126 clk_bulk_disable_unprepare(priv->data->nclks, priv->clk); in uniphier_regulator_remove()
/openbmc/linux/drivers/pci/controller/dwc/
H A Dpcie-bt1.c397 clk_bulk_disable_unprepare(DW_PCIE_NUM_CORE_CLKS, pci->core_clks); in bt1_pcie_full_stop_bus()
399 clk_bulk_disable_unprepare(DW_PCIE_NUM_APP_CLKS, pci->app_clks); in bt1_pcie_full_stop_bus()
521 clk_bulk_disable_unprepare(DW_PCIE_NUM_CORE_CLKS, pci->core_clks); in bt1_pcie_cold_start_bus()
524 clk_bulk_disable_unprepare(DW_PCIE_NUM_APP_CLKS, pci->app_clks); in bt1_pcie_cold_start_bus()
H A Dpcie-qcom.c351 clk_bulk_disable_unprepare(ARRAY_SIZE(res->clks), res->clks); in qcom_pcie_deinit_2_1_0()
478 clk_bulk_disable_unprepare(ARRAY_SIZE(res->clks), res->clks); in qcom_pcie_deinit_1_0_0()
510 clk_bulk_disable_unprepare(ARRAY_SIZE(res->clks), res->clks); in qcom_pcie_init_1_0_0()
574 clk_bulk_disable_unprepare(ARRAY_SIZE(res->clks), res->clks); in qcom_pcie_deinit_2_3_2()
678 clk_bulk_disable_unprepare(res->num_clks, res->clks); in qcom_pcie_deinit_2_4_0()
749 clk_bulk_disable_unprepare(ARRAY_SIZE(res->clks), res->clks); in qcom_pcie_deinit_2_3_3()
955 clk_bulk_disable_unprepare(res->num_clks, res->clks); in qcom_pcie_init_2_7_0()
973 clk_bulk_disable_unprepare(res->num_clks, res->clks); in qcom_pcie_deinit_2_7_0()
1082 clk_bulk_disable_unprepare(ARRAY_SIZE(res->clks), res->clks); in qcom_pcie_deinit_2_9_0()
/openbmc/linux/drivers/phy/qualcomm/
H A Dphy-qcom-usb-ss.c114 clk_bulk_disable_unprepare(NUM_BULK_CLKS, priv->clks); in qcom_ssphy_power_on()
129 clk_bulk_disable_unprepare(NUM_BULK_CLKS, priv->clks); in qcom_ssphy_power_off()
H A Dphy-qcom-usb-hs-28nm.c278 clk_bulk_disable_unprepare(priv->num_clks, priv->clks); in qcom_snps_hsphy_init()
286 clk_bulk_disable_unprepare(priv->num_clks, priv->clks); in qcom_snps_hsphy_exit()
/openbmc/linux/sound/soc/qcom/
H A Dlpass-apq8016.c211 clk_bulk_disable_unprepare(drvdata->num_clks, drvdata->clks); in apq8016_lpass_init()
219 clk_bulk_disable_unprepare(drvdata->num_clks, drvdata->clks); in apq8016_lpass_exit()
H A Dlpass-sc7180.c159 clk_bulk_disable_unprepare(drvdata->num_clks, drvdata->clks); in sc7180_lpass_exit()
174 clk_bulk_disable_unprepare(drvdata->num_clks, drvdata->clks); in sc7180_lpass_dev_suspend()
H A Dlpass-sc7280.c232 clk_bulk_disable_unprepare(drvdata->num_clks, drvdata->clks); in sc7280_lpass_exit()
247 clk_bulk_disable_unprepare(drvdata->num_clks, drvdata->clks); in sc7280_lpass_dev_suspend()
/openbmc/linux/drivers/mmc/host/
H A Dsdhci-of-dwcmshc.c580 clk_bulk_disable_unprepare(RK35xx_MAX_CLKS, in dwcmshc_probe()
616 clk_bulk_disable_unprepare(RK35xx_MAX_CLKS, in dwcmshc_remove()
641 clk_bulk_disable_unprepare(RK35xx_MAX_CLKS, in dwcmshc_suspend()
680 clk_bulk_disable_unprepare(RK35xx_MAX_CLKS, in dwcmshc_resume()
/openbmc/linux/drivers/pwm/
H A Dpwm-sprd.c117 clk_bulk_disable_unprepare(SPRD_PWM_CHN_CLKS_NUM, chn->clks); in sprd_pwm_get_state()
204 clk_bulk_disable_unprepare(SPRD_PWM_CHN_CLKS_NUM, chn->clks); in sprd_pwm_apply()
/openbmc/linux/drivers/pmdomain/mediatek/
H A Dmtk-pm-domains.c257 clk_bulk_disable_unprepare(pd->num_subsys_clks, pd->subsys_clks); in scpsys_power_on()
259 clk_bulk_disable_unprepare(pd->num_clks, pd->clks); in scpsys_power_on()
284 clk_bulk_disable_unprepare(pd->num_subsys_clks, pd->subsys_clks); in scpsys_power_off()
299 clk_bulk_disable_unprepare(pd->num_clks, pd->clks); in scpsys_power_off()
/openbmc/linux/drivers/phy/rockchip/
H A Dphy-rockchip-snps-pcie3.c202 clk_bulk_disable_unprepare(priv->num_clks, priv->clks); in rochchip_p3phy_init()
212 clk_bulk_disable_unprepare(priv->num_clks, priv->clks); in rochchip_p3phy_exit()
/openbmc/linux/sound/soc/sof/imx/
H A Dimx-common.c97 clk_bulk_disable_unprepare(clks->num_dsp_clks, clks->dsp_clks); in imx8_disable_clocks()
/openbmc/linux/drivers/usb/host/
H A Dxhci-mtk.c696 clk_bulk_disable_unprepare(BULK_CLKS_NUM, mtk->clks); in xhci_mtk_probe()
731 clk_bulk_disable_unprepare(BULK_CLKS_NUM, mtk->clks); in xhci_mtk_remove()
759 clk_bulk_disable_unprepare(BULK_CLKS_NUM, mtk->clks); in xhci_mtk_suspend()
801 clk_bulk_disable_unprepare(BULK_CLKS_NUM, mtk->clks); in xhci_mtk_resume()
/openbmc/linux/drivers/interconnect/qcom/
H A Dicc-rpm.c522 clk_bulk_disable_unprepare(qp->num_intf_clks, in qnoc_probe()
540 clk_bulk_disable_unprepare(qp->num_intf_clks, in qnoc_probe()
550 clk_bulk_disable_unprepare(qp->num_intf_clks, qp->intf_clks); in qnoc_probe()
/openbmc/linux/drivers/bus/
H A Dsimple-pm-bus.c94 clk_bulk_disable_unprepare(bus->num_clks, bus->clks); in simple_pm_bus_runtime_suspend()

12345